Rose Cottage

A Grade II Listed Building in Swithland, Leicestershire

Rose Cottage, 160 Main Street, Swithland

Uploader's Comments

Cottage of early C19. Slate and granite rubble stone, red brick right gable, with Swithland slate roof and red brick chimney stacks. Two storeys of two 3 light casement windows with brick cambered lintels. C20 central door with slated hood. On left end outshut with door and 2 light casements above. On right end a one storey extension with 4 light casement. A lower extension further right with garage doors. (Photo Nov 2014).
